Every Easter Monday, the streets of Morestel transform into a giant flea market. For over two decades, the Solifrat association has organized this flea market, which has become a staple in the calendar for treasure hunters in Nord-Isère and Bugey. The event takes over the Place des Halles and the Grande Rue, the historic arteries of this charming medieval town.
Morestel, nicknamed the "City of Painters," offers a remarkable architectural setting for this open-air flea market. Stalls line the Grande Rue, bordered by old houses, creating a picturesque treasure hunt route that appeals to both lovers of antique objects and Easter Monday strollers. Professionals and individuals share the spaces, offering antiques, second-hand goods, tableware, trinkets, books, and collectible items.
The Solifrat association, which organizes this event, is committed to a solidarity approach. The profits generated by the event contribute to financing the association's social actions. Registration is mandatory for exhibitors, and setup takes place between 6 am and 7:30 am. The courtyard of the Victor Hugo school also hosts some of the stands.
A commune of about 4,500 inhabitants, Morestel is ideally located at the borders of Isère, Ain, and Savoie. The town, which has inspired many painters—hence its nickname—boasts a rich architectural heritage with its medieval houses, its tower, and its picturesque alleys. The Easter Monday flea market is an opportunity to combine treasure hunting with heritage discovery in an exceptional setting.
